Friendship, St. George, June 8, 1801.
RAN AWAY, the 1st of February last, a stout Negro Man, named
POLLUX, a Malabar, marked upon his right shoulder E [a
l’envers et tourne vers la gauche et decale vers le bas]C, heart
on top; he is artful enough, and was seen in St. Mary with a
false ticket. Whoever will bring him to the subscriber, shall
receive Five Pounds reward: All persons are hereby cautioned
against harbouring or giving him tickets, as they may depend
the law will be strictly put in force.
RAYMOND CHEVOLLEAU.
